DESCRIPTION
The AGXV high volume, low pressure spray gun
(spray pistol) is used on automatic and semi-
automatic machines where mass production
spraying is necessary, or hand spraying is not
accurate enough.  Models and application infor-
mation follows. All models are designed to pro-
vide maximum transfer efficiency by limiting air
cap pressure to 10 psi (0.7 bar) (in the U.S., this
complies with rules issued by SCAQMD and
other air quality authorities)
.  Air cap pressure
can be measured with an optional air cap test kit.
See "ACCESSORIES" on Page 8.

Most finishing materials can be atomized with
either the 28 or 33A air caps. The 28 or 33A caps
should be used where possible as they con-
sume less air volume (CFM) and have slightly
better transfer efficiency than the 46 MP or
83MP air caps.  However, more difficult to atom-
ize materials (i.e. low VOC's) or high flow appli-
cations over 12 oz./min. (360 cc/min.), are ideal
for the 46 MP maximum performer air cap, fluid
tip and baffle combination.  Also available is the
83MP (maximum performer) for even higher
flows 17 oz./min. (510 cc/min.) and above and
higher viscosities.  Refer to the air cap chart for
more information.
Note
This gun may be used with chlorinated
solvents.  Aluminum is not used in fluid
passages.  If using chlorinated solvents,
make sure all other fluid handling compo-
nents are also compatible.
A list of materials used in the construction
of this equipment is available upon request.
SPECIFICATIONS
P1 – Maximum Inlet Pressure – 100 PSI (7 bar)
P2 – Maximum Fluid Pressure – 100 psi (7 bar)
P3 – Cylinder Air Pressure
– Min. **50 psi (3.5 bar)
– Max. 100 psi (7 bar)
Weight without mounting stud – 26 oz. (738 g)
Weight with mounting stud – 30.5 oz. (865 g)
Mounting stud diameter – 3/4" (19 mm)
Wetted Parts – 300 and 400 S/S, Teflon, Poly.
(See Chart  2 for tip/needle information)
Hose Connections –
Fluid Inlet – 3/8" NPS(M)
Cylinder Air – 1/4" NPS(M)
Atomization Air – 1/4" NPS(M)

** For installations where 50 psi (3.4 bar) cylinder air is not
available, the inner (red) piston spring can be removed
which lowers the minimum cylinder air to approxi-
mately 37 psi (2.5 bar).  Refer to "OPERATION", Pg. 4
